NXT General Manager Ava announced Eddy Thorpe’s withdrawal from tonight’s Iron Survivor Challenge at Deadline due to medical reasons. The announcement came following a backstage attack on Thorpe by an unidentified assailant during Tuesday’s NXT.

Thorpe had secured his spot in the match after winning the Last Chance Fatal Four Way qualifying match on December 3, defeating Cedric Alexander, Lexis King, and Axiom. The 34-year-old competitor was set to join Ethan Page, Nathan Frazer, Je’Von Evans, and Wes Lee in the Iron Survivor Challenge.

“Due to the heinous attack he suffered this past Tuesday, Eddy Thorpe has been ruled out of the Men’s Iron Survivor Challenge,” Ava stated in a video posted on Instagram. “We still don’t know who attacked Eddy and we’re continuing to look into this situation.”

The NXT General Manager confirmed she would find a replacement for Thorpe before tonight’s premium live event in Minneapolis. “For Deadline tonight, I will find a suitable replacement to take Eddy’s spot in the Men’s Iron Survivor Challenge,” she added.

The identity of Thorpe’s attacker remains unknown, with NXT officials continuing their investigation into the incident.
